The coin 1/2 penny from Jamaica comprises 7 issues minted between 1955 and 1963. The standout issue of the series is the 1957 one. Here you will find all its numismatic data to appraise it —composition, weight, diameter, mint and mintage—, its value trend and the collectors who own it.
